Finding Great Deals When Shopping Online For Items

There is nothing quite like the rush of finding a tremendous bargain online. But, the best way to become an expert an online shopping is to research all you can on the tricks and tips of the trade. Continue reading the article below, and you can be a true pro in no time.

When you enjoy the convenience of frequent online shopping, it’s very important to keep changing the passwords you use for each account. Every couple of weeks or so, make up a new password for your bank and the shopping sites directly. Use abstract words, combined with numbers and other odd characters for the strongest passwords.

Before shopping from a store that is new to you, find out what the store’s reputation is like. You can usually do an online search and find out what others think of the business. It is best to do this so you do not find out the hard way and lose your money.

Although it may seem tedious, make sure you read the contract and terms before you purchase at a website. These documents have valuable information on what you can and cannot do when you have an issue with the item that you bought. Read them thoroughly so that you do not have an unwelcome surprise when trying to return items.

Be wary of any emails you receive, even if they appear to be from a retailer you trust. Never click on a link that directs you to a site other than the one you shopped on. If you do, you may become vulnerable to a scam. Rather than clicking on an email hyperlink, just go up to your browser and type in the web site you want to go to. It is much safer that way.

Keep your computer protected. If you are doing any shopping online, especially at a site you are not familiar with, make sure your computer has up-to-date virus protection. This is essential to prevent your computer from being infected by malicious websites. There are several free options that can be found on most search engines.

Prior to entering credit card numbers onto a site, check the URL. If the URL begins with “https” rather than “http”, then you know that the website is secure. If it doesn’t say this then you don’t know what could be happening to your information and that could spell trouble later on down the road.

If you receive an email that looks like it is sent from a legitimate site offering you a great deal, make sure that you check the address bar before buying anything. There are many scammers out there that spoof legitimate sites in order to get unsuspecting people’s personal information.

You should never do some online shopping while being connected a public wifi. Wait until you are on a secured Internet connection to purchase the products you want. Your payment information could be accessed by a third party if you purchase a product while being connected to a public network.

It is a good idea to create an account at any online store you shop at frequently. Doing this will save you a lot of time when checking out. In addition, you can save money. You can get their newsletter which may include information on discounts. If you have an account, you can track orders and keep tabs on returns much more easily.

Do a quick web search for promo keys and discounts prior to making any online purchases. Often, there are discount keys out there that you may not be aware of! This could save you 10% to 20%, or offer you things like free shipping or a discount on a secondary item.

Most credit cards offer an identify-theft protection program. Therefore, when shopping online, only use your credit card to make purchases. If you ever have a charge show up that you are concerned about, your credit card company will look into the matter for you. Debit cards are much riskier and should be avoided.

Use different shopping sites. Different online stores specialize in different products or areas of interest. Bookmark the sites that you like so you can return to them later. They give the greatest available prices. A lot of times, they won’t even charge for shipping.

One site which offers great deals every day is Woot.com. At midnight central time they post an item at a super discounted price, and you have to grab them while they are available. Not only is this fun to do, it can save you a bundle on electronics and computer hardware.

If you lead a hectic lifestyle, or work odd hours, it can often be difficult to make it to the store before they close. Online shopping, however, is something that you can do at any hour of the day (or night!), and may therefore be a more convenient choice for you.

If you want to do some shopping online, check with your credit card company and see if they offer one-time use credit card numbers. These card numbers can only be used one time and protect your “real” credit card number from theft. This service is almost always free to account holders.

When you buy from an online merchant, try to combine your purchases together into one shipment. Shipping costs can be high if you are just buying one or two items, sometimes as high as the price of the item. If you buy many things during the same shopping session, the shipping cost is more cost effective.
